Analysis

Algeria recorded 157,129 SLC for tangerines, mandarins, clementines — producer price in 2021.

The figure is down 1.5% on the previous year and up 100.2% over ten years.

Over the whole period, tangerines, mandarins, clementines — producer price in Algeria peaked at 159,523 SLC in 2020 and was at its lowest, 16,000 SLC, in 1995.

That places Algeria 10th out of 44 countries with data for 2021, putting it in the top quarter.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 21 years of available data.

This sub-domain contains data on agriculture producer prices and the producer price index. Agriculture producer prices are prices received by farmers for primary crops, live animals and livestock primary products as collected at the point of initial sale (prices paid at the farm gate). Annual data are provided from 1991 (while mothly data start in January 2010) for 180 countries and 212 products. The producer price index is the index of agricultural producer prices that measures the average annual change over time in the selling prices received by farmers (prices at the farm gate or at the first point of sale). The three categories of producer price index available in FAOSTAT comprise: single-item price index, commodity group index and the agriculture producer price index.
